Wound healing markers are biological parameters – including molecules, proteins, cells, and clinical signs – that provide information about the current status and progression of wound healing. They are used in modern wound care to objectively monitor the healing process, detect complications such as infections or chronic wound states early, and guide therapeutic decisions.

Matrix metalloproteinases are enzymes that break down and remodel the extracellular matrix. In chronic wounds, MMPs are often persistently elevated, inhibiting the healing process. The balance between MMPs and their inhibitors (TIMPs) is an important diagnostic indicator of wound status.
Collagen is the most important structural protein of the skin and connective tissue. The transition from type III collagen (dominant in early healing phases) to type I collagen (dominant in the remodeling phase) is a sign of advancing wound healing.

In chronic wounds – such as diabetic foot ulcers, pressure ulcers, or venous leg ulcers – the normal healing phases are disrupted. These wounds typically show chronically elevated inflammatory markers, an imbalance of MMPs, and reduced concentrations of growth factors. Assessing wound healing markers in this context enables targeted diagnosis and therapy management.

Knowledge of the wound healing marker profile enables individualized therapy. Growth factors can be applied specifically, inflammatory responses can be modulated, and MMP-inhibiting wound dressings can be used. Modern wound dressings increasingly incorporate integrated biosensors for continuous monitoring of wound healing markers.
